Fresh peach burrata salad with basil and balsamic glaze

Peach Burrata Salad Made Easy

This easy peach burrata salad combines ripe peaches, creamy burrata, fresh basil, and arugula with a drizzle of balsamic glaze. Ready in 10 minutes, it’s a refreshing summer salad perfect for casual meals or elegant gatherings.
Prep Time 10 minutes
Total Time 10 minutes
Course Salad
Cuisine Mediterranean
Servings 4
Calories 285 kcal

Ingredients
  

  • 3 –4 medium ripe peaches sliced
  • 8 oz 2 balls burrata cheese
  • 4 cups arugula or mixed greens washed and dried
  • 1/2 cup fresh basil leaves torn
  • 3 tablespoons extra virgin olive oil
  • 1 –2 tablespoons balsamic glaze or aged balsamic
  • 1 tablespoon freshly squeezed lemon juice
  • Sea salt flake, to taste
  • Freshly cracked black pepper to taste
  • 1 teaspoon honey optional, if peaches are underripe
  • 1 loaf crusty bread optional, for serving

Instructions
 

  • Wash and dry the peaches, then slice into uniform wedges.
  • Wash and spin-dry arugula or mixed greens. Pat completely dry.
  • Arrange the greens on a serving platter, scatter torn basil leaves on top.
  • Layer peach slices evenly over the greens.
  • Place whole or torn burrata cheese on top of the peaches.
  • In a small bowl, whisk together olive oil, lemon juice, salt, and pepper.
  • Drizzle the dressing lightly over the salad.
  • Finish with balsamic glaze, a sprinkle of sea salt, and extra basil if desired.
  • Serve immediately with crusty bread on the side.

Notes

  • Peach choice: For the sweetest flavor, use fully ripe peaches that are slightly soft to the touch. If peaches are firm, let them ripen at room temperature for a day or two.
 
  • Burrata tip: Remove burrata from the fridge 10–15 minutes before serving for the creamiest texture.
 
  • Greens swap: Arugula adds a peppery bite, but mixed baby greens or spinach work well too.
 
  • Balsamic choice: Use aged balsamic for a milder sweetness, or balsamic glaze for a thicker, more concentrated flavor.
 
  • Make ahead: Prep the greens, slice the peaches, and mix the dressing ahead of time, but assemble the salad just before serving to keep it fresh.
 
  • Optional add-ins: Toasted nuts (pistachios, hazelnuts, or walnuts) add a great crunch. You can also add grilled chicken or shrimp to make it a complete meal.
